A Betrothed!
"Hey, gaki, where have you been?" Jiraiya called as he heard Naruto enter the cluster of rooms the two had been staying in.
"Out," the fourteen year old called vaguely, placing his bag on the floor of his room.
"Out?" Jiraiya immediately perked up. Normally Naruto gave a detailed description of where he had gone and what had happened immediately upon arrival, but this time…"Out where?"
"Just out," he responded, appearing in the doorframe of the room.
Jiraiya's eyes were immediately drawn to the boy. He wasn't in his normal orange jumpsuit, and that alone had his curiosity piqued. "What are you wearing?"
"Hm?" Naruto looked down at his clothes as though he had forgotten what he wore. "Just some clothes baa-chan got for me."
A white eyebrow shot up. "Talkative, aren't you."
"Fine. If you need to know, I was on a date with my girlfriend."
Immediately Jiraiya's eyes bugged out. "You have a girlfriend! When did that happen?"
"The second day we were here," Naruto replied, eyeing his mentor warily.
"Oh?" A leer began to form. "What does she look like?"
"None of your business."
"Oh come on!"
"Nope."
"Fine. Sit down boy, it's time we had a talk." Jiraiya ordered, pointing at the floor in front of him.
With a skeptical expression, Naruto settled himself on the floor, not sure what to expect.
"Now," Jiraiya began officially, "I am going to instruct you on the necessities of knowledge regarding women. Lesson one –" he raised a finger to cut off Naruto's protest. "How to woo one. Find out what she likes, and make sure to buy her it at the soonest chance. When you go shopping offer everything at your treat, and don't let her buy a single thing. Offer to go window shopping, and when something catches her eye, admire it. Got it?" The finger lowered, pointing at the boy.
"Yeah yeah, buy her everything she wants, admire what she likes. I know all this. Why do I have to –"
"Lesson two. Manners. I know you never had formal training in this category," he commented disparagingly, "so listen closely. When she goes to sit down, pull out her chair. Take her jacket from her, and hang it on the back, or a coatrack if available. Always walk her back to her door when the date is over, and never, never," his eyes twinkled, "forget that kiss goodnight."
"Ew, kissing!" Naruto exclaimed, rocking backwards from his spot on the floor. "Gross!"
"Gross!" Jiraiya was outraged. "Kissing is only the first part of one of the best parts of life! How can it be gross?"
"It's disgusting!" Naruto retorted, glaring up at the man. "Why would you want to – ew!"
Jiraiya heaved a sigh, shaking his head in dismay. "You have much to learn my young pupil. As such, my next task for you is to read this." He produced a lurid pink covered book from nowhere, handing it to his student. "Cover to cover by tomorrow morning."
Naruto took the book skeptically, looking at the cover, which had a man chasing a woman in a bright red dress on it. "Isn't this one of those –"
"No!" Jiraiya told him swiftly, knowing if he thought it was at all dirty the boy wouldn't touch it. "Just read it. Goodnight." The moment the boy was out of the room he turned off the lights and pretended to be asleep. Naruto wouldn't bother him until the morning if he thought it involved waking up the white-haired sannin.
The next morning Jiraiya woke up late, stretching and yawning widely. He listened for any exclamations of either disgust or delight coming from Naruto's room, but instead heard nothing but silence. Hm.
He got up, tiptoeing quietly over to the open doorway to the blond boy's room, and peered in. The book was open to about a quarter of the way through, in front of Naruto. But the boy himself was curled up in a ball on his side, eyes wide and staring at the wall unseeing, arms wrapped around his knees.
"Naruto?" Jiraiya asked, walking into the room to pick up the book and waving a hand in front of Naruto's eyes. "Naruto?"
"Y-Y-You…" the boy stuttered out, eyes shifting to look up at the man's face but not moving otherwise. "Why would you do that to me!"
Even the memory caused his cheeks to flame bright red to Jiraiya's amusement. "Let's see where you got to…" he looked down at the page, reading the words written there. "You didn't even get to the best part! If you can't handle this, how do you expect to become a man?"
"That isn't how to become a man!" Naruto retorted, slowly unwinding. "That's how to become a pervert!"
"What's the difference?"
"Everything! I couldn't do that to –" he broke off before telling his girlfriend's name.
"Yes, yes?" Jiraiya prodded eagerly.
Naruto moved quickly, grabbing the offending book from Jiraiya's hands and throwing it out the window. "To my betrothed!" he finished, just to see the look on the man's face.
Immediately the Sannin's jaw dropped, and he even forgot to cry about his desecrated book. "No no no!" he howled. "That's not how you do it! You don't tie yourself down, you play the field, you experiment, you – how did you get a betrothed this fast? Why did you get a betrothed?" Then his eyes narrowed at the grin Naruto was giving him. "Why you…"
He lunged for the blond boy as he ducked under the man's arm, quickly escaping out the window onto the next roof. "I'm going to go meet her, see ya!" he called before disappearing, Jiraiya struggling out the window behind him trying to pursue, but unable to fit through the small opening.
"Get back here!" he yelled after his fleeing student, growling as the boy only waved over his shoulder. "I won't let you do this to yourself!"
